If y varies directly with x, then the relationship can be expressed as y = kx, where k is the constant of variation. To find the value of k, we can use the given values: y = 25 when x = 2.
Substituting these values into the equation: 25 = k * 2
Solving for k: k = 25 / 2 k = 12.5
Now that we have the value of k, we can use it to find y when x = 0.5: y = k * x y = 12.5 * 0.5 y = 6.25
